Queen Charlotte TrafficQueen Charlotte WeatherQueen Charlotte Petrol StationsQueen Charlotte HotelsQueen Charlotte RestaurantsQueen Charlotte Car RepairQueen Charlotte more service
Queen Charlotte City Info
2025-01-22
Let's chat about Queen Charlotte
2025-01-22
Guest